René's favorite bread

Ingredients for 2 servings:

  • 300 g wholemeal spelt flour
  • 300 g spelt flour type 630
  • 150 g wheat flour type 550
  • 1 packet of dry yeast
  • 1 ½ tsp salt
  • 75 g sunflower seeds
  • 40 g flaxseed
  • 40 g sesame seeds
  • ½ tsp sugar
  • 600 ml water, lukewarm
  • Rye flakes, fine or oat flakes
  • Flour for the bowl

Instructions

Working time approx. 15 minutes; Rest time approx. 2 hours; Cooking/baking time approx. 1 hour; Total time approx. 3 hours 15 minutes

Three-grain spelt wheat bread, fluffy

Mix the dry ingredients and knead with warm water in a food processor for about 5-8 minutes. Transfer to a large floured bowl, cover, and let rise slowly in the refrigerator overnight, or in a warm water bath or in a warm place until the dough has doubled in size. Let rise again while the oven preheats to 240°C (top/bottom heat). If the dough is too soft, knead in rye flakes or oats. Shape into two loaves. It’s best to warm the baking sheet on the stovetop over low heat. Then place the loaves on top, score them with a sharp knife, and spray with water. Cover and let rise until the oven reaches 240°C (475°F). Pour half a cup of water onto the floor of the oven and place the loaves on the lowest rack. Bake for 10 minutes at 240°C (top/bottom heat), then reduce the temperature to 190°C (375°F) and bake for 50 minutes. This recipe yields approximately 1200g of bread.
